METHOD FOR PRODUCING AN INHIBITOR OF CARBON DIOXIDE AND HYDROGEN SULFIDE CORROSION

机译:一种生产二氧化碳和硫化氢腐蚀抑制剂的方法

摘要

FIELD: oil and gas industry.;SUBSTANCE: invention relates to oil industry and can be used to protect oilfield equipment from corrosion in mineralized water and water-oil environments containing carbon dioxide and hydrogen sulphide. Method includes preparation of an active inhibitor base by reacting a mixture of alkylamines selected from the group consisting of cocoamine, tallow amine, ethylenediamine, diethylenetriamine, aminoethylethanolamine, aminoethylpiperazine and piperazine, with a triglyceride or a product of its processing selected from the group consisting of rapeseed oil, soybean oil, tall oil, fatty acid methyl ester, fatty acid ethyl ester, biodiesel and tall oil fatty acid, the reaction being carried out by distilling off the water and/or alcohol produced at a temperature of 140–240 °C and turbulent mixing of the reaction mass with the release of glycerol, water and/or alcohol, and a quaternary ammonium compound in the form of benzalkonium chloride is added to the obtained aqueous alcohol solution of the active base of the inhibitor, with the following component ratio, %: active base of corrosion inhibitor 20.0–40.0; benzalkonium chloride 10.0–30.0; aqueous-alcoholic solution 65.0–95.0.;EFFECT: increase protection against carbon dioxide and hydrogen sulfide corrosion.;1 cl, 4 ex
